Finding specific details like package duration and pricing for guided meditation resorts and retreats in Himachal Pradesh can vary widely based on the amenities, location, and specific offerings of each retreat center. Here are a few well-regarded options known for their meditation programs in Himachal Pradesh:
Osho Nisarga, Dharamshala: Known for its serene location amidst the Himalayas, Osho Nisarga offers various meditation retreats focusing on mindfulness and inner exploration. They provide different packages ranging from weekend retreats to longer stays, with prices typically starting from ₹10,000 onwards for a weekend retreat.
Vipassana Meditation Center, Dharamshala: Specializes in Vipassana meditation retreats, emphasizing silent meditation and mindfulness. Courses are typically offered for 10 days, following a donation-based model where participants contribute according to their means and ability.
Tushita Meditation Centre, McLeod Ganj: Offers Tibetan Buddhist meditation retreats and courses, including guided meditation sessions, teachings, and workshops. Retreat durations vary from a few days to several weeks, with accommodation and meal packages priced affordably for budget-conscious travelers.
Ayurvedic and Yoga Retreats: Many Ayurvedic resorts in Himachal Pradesh, such as those in Rishikesh and Dharamshala, incorporate guided meditation as part of their holistic wellness programs. These retreats often include daily yoga sessions, Ayurvedic treatments, and meditation practices, with prices varying based on the duration and level of accommodation.
Private Retreats and Eco-Resorts: For those seeking a more personalized experience, several eco-resorts and private retreat centers in remote areas of Himachal Pradesh offer customized meditation retreats. Prices and package durations can vary widely based on individual preferences and the exclusivity of the location.

The history of guided meditation in Himachal Pradesh is intertwined with the region's rich spiritual heritage and the influence of Tibetan Buddhism. Here are some key aspects of the history of guided meditation in this Himalayan region:
Tibetan Buddhist Influence: Himachal Pradesh, especially areas like Dharamshala and McLeod Ganj, has been a significant center for Tibetan Buddhism since the 1959 Tibetan uprising. His Holiness the 14th Dalai Lama and many Tibetan Buddhist monks and scholars sought refuge in this region, bringing with them centuries-old meditation practices.
Establishment of Meditation Centers: Over the decades, numerous meditation centers and monasteries have been established in Himachal Pradesh, offering teachings and practices in various forms of meditation. These centers serve both the local community and international visitors seeking spiritual guidance and personal transformation through meditation.
Integration with Ayurveda and Yoga: Alongside Tibetan Buddhist meditation practices, Himachal Pradesh has seen the integration of meditation with Ayurveda and yoga. Ayurvedic retreats and wellness centers in the region often incorporate guided meditation as part of holistic healing and wellness programs.
Rise of Wellness Tourism: In recent years, Himachal Pradesh has emerged as a popular destination for wellness tourism, attracting visitors from around the world seeking meditation retreats and guided meditation experiences amidst the serene Himalayan landscape.
Promotion of Mindfulness: Guided meditation in Himachal Pradesh has contributed to the promotion of mindfulness practices beyond religious and cultural boundaries. It has become accessible to people of various backgrounds, promoting mental well-being and stress reduction in today's fast-paced world.
Cultural Exchange and Learning: The presence of international meditation teachers, workshops, and retreats in Himachal Pradesh has facilitated cultural exchange and learning. Visitors have the opportunity to learn different meditation techniques and deepen their spiritual understanding through guided practices.

In Himachal Pradesh, guided meditation therapies and treatments typically encompass various techniques aimed at promoting relaxation, mindfulness, and overall well-being amidst the serene Himalayan environment. Here's a range of guided meditation therapies and treatments you might find in the region:
Mindfulness Meditation: Focuses on present-moment awareness, helping individuals observe thoughts and sensations without judgment. It enhances mindfulness, emotional regulation, and stress reduction.
Visualization Meditation: Involves guided imagery to create mental pictures that evoke relaxation, positivity, and inner peace. It can aid in reducing anxiety, enhancing creativity, and promoting healing.
Mantra Meditation: Utilizes repeated sounds or words (mantras) to quiet the mind and deepen concentration. Mantra meditation promotes relaxation, spiritual growth, and mental clarity.
Breath Awareness Meditation: Focuses on the breath as a focal point for meditation, helping individuals cultivate mindfulness, reduce stress, and enhance overall well-being.
Chakra Meditation: Focuses on the body's energy centers (chakras), using guided visualization and breathing techniques to balance energy flow, promote emotional stability, and enhance vitality.
Loving-Kindness Meditation: Involves cultivating feelings of compassion and goodwill towards oneself and others. It promotes emotional resilience, empathy, and a positive outlook on life.
Sound Healing Meditation: Integrates soothing sounds, such as Tibetan singing bowls or nature sounds, to facilitate relaxation, reduce stress, and promote inner harmony.
Walking Meditation: Combines mindfulness with physical movement, allowing individuals to focus on each step and sensory experience. Walking meditation enhances mindfulness, reduces stress, and promotes grounding.
Yoga Nidra: Known as yogic sleep, Yoga Nidra is a guided meditation technique that induces deep relaxation and conscious awareness. It promotes stress relief, emotional healing, and rejuvenation.
Metta Meditation: Also known as loving-kindness meditation, Metta meditation involves generating feelings of compassion and goodwill towards oneself and others. It cultivates emotional resilience, empathy, and inner peace.

The duration of guided meditation sessions or programs in Himachal Pradesh can vary widely depending on the specific retreat center, workshop, or individual session. Here are some common durations you might find:
Single Sessions: Guided meditation sessions can range from 30 minutes to 1 hour for a single session. These sessions are often offered as introductory experiences or as part of a daily practice.
Half-Day Workshops: Some meditation centers in Himachal Pradesh offer half-day workshops that include guided meditation along with teachings, discussions, and practical exercises. These workshops typically last 3 to 4 hours.
Full-Day Retreats: Full-day meditation retreats may extend from morning to evening, offering multiple guided meditation sessions interspersed with breaks, teachings, and silent contemplation. These retreats provide a deeper immersion into meditation practice and mindfulness.
Weekend Retreats: Weekend meditation retreats in Himachal Pradesh usually span 2 to 3 days, offering a structured program of guided meditation, yoga sessions, discussions, and opportunities for reflection. Participants can experience significant relaxation and rejuvenation within this timeframe.
Multi-Day Retreats: Longer meditation retreats can last from 5 days to several weeks. These retreats offer a more intensive exploration of guided meditation techniques, spiritual teachings, and personal growth practices. They often include accommodations, meals, and a comprehensive program designed for deep transformation and healing.
Customized Programs: Some meditation centers in Himachal Pradesh offer customized programs tailored to individual or group needs. These programs may include daily guided meditation sessions combined with additional activities like hiking, Ayurvedic treatments, or cultural experiences.

Guided meditation is generally not specifically aimed at weight loss as its primary objective, but it can indirectly support weight management through various mechanisms related to stress reduction, mindfulness, and overall well-being. Here’s how guided meditation practiced in Himachal Pradesh can contribute to a holistic approach to weight management:
Stress Reduction: Guided meditation helps reduce stress levels, which can be beneficial for weight management. Chronic stress is linked to weight gain due to increased cortisol levels, which can lead to cravings for unhealthy foods and disrupted sleep patterns.
Emotional Eating: Meditation techniques, including mindfulness practices, can help individuals become more aware of emotional triggers for eating. By cultivating mindfulness, individuals may develop healthier responses to emotional cues, reducing the likelihood of emotional eating episodes.
Mindful Eating: Guided meditation encourages mindfulness in daily activities, including eating. Practicing mindful eating involves paying full attention to the sensory experience of eating, which can lead to better food choices, improved digestion, and enhanced satisfaction from meals.
Improved Sleep: Meditation practices can improve sleep quality by calming the mind and promoting relaxation. Quality sleep is crucial for weight management as inadequate sleep can disrupt hormone levels related to hunger and satiety.
Supporting Lifestyle Changes: Guided meditation retreats or workshops in Himachal Pradesh often complement other wellness practices such as yoga, healthy eating guidance, and physical activities like hiking. These integrated programs support overall lifestyle changes conducive to weight management.
Body Awareness: Through guided meditation, individuals may develop a greater awareness and acceptance of their bodies. This can foster a positive body image and motivation for making sustainable lifestyle choices that support weight management.
